Shooting interior photography is so much like shooting product photography in that it’s important to make sure the hues and saturation of a piece of furniture, or wallpaper, or even floorboard are matching the product’s being photographed. Although I’d like to think that my camera can sometimes enhance the scene it is shooting, sometimes it strips away the minutiae and subtleties of what a client is trying to show. This is why I like to shoot tethered to a computer when shooting these sorts of projects so the client and I can work with making sure we are capturing exactly what they intend to show.
